Charles H. Koontz
Charles H. Koontz, Winona Lake, went home to be with his Lord and Savior Whom he loved and served, at 3:25 p.m. on Saturday, Dec. 18, 2021, at Grace Village Health Care, Winona Lake, at the age of 91.
Charles was born in Masontown, Pa., on June 22, 1930, to Herman W. and Myra S. Koontz. On April 13, 1957, he married Alice E. Snider in Pennsylvania, and they were blessed to share the next 64 years celebrating anniversaries, holidays and birthdays, raising their children and becoming grandparents and great-grandparents.
Charles graduated from Jefferson High School in Roanoke, Va. He completed his undergraduate degree at Bryan College in Dayton, Tenn., and his divinity degree from Grace Theological Seminary in Winona Lake.
Following graduation, Charles became pastor of the McHenry Avenue Grace Brethren Church in Modesto, Calif. He returned to Winona Lake in 1960 to become the manager of the Brethren Missionary Herald Bookstore. Later he was the manager of the Christian Light Bookstore in Nappanee. After retirement, he worked for Patona Bay and Ace Hardware in Warsaw.
He enjoyed the fellowship of his church family at Winona Lake Grace Brethren Church where he was a member for more than 60 years, serving as a trustee, usher and financial secretary. One of his passions was being involved with Right to Life of North Central Indiana.
Charles enjoyed spending time on the lake and boating with his family. He could be found cheering at the many Grace College basketball games he attended. He also enjoyed reading his Bible, doing jigsaw puzzles, Gaither cruises with Alice and traveling to watch his children and grandchildren perform and play sports.
He was a wonderful husband, father, grandfather and great-grandfather. Charles loved his Lord and Savior, Jesus Christ, and though his family will dearly miss him, they are rejoicing that he will be spending Christmas in Heaven.
Charles is survived by his wife of 64 years, Alice E. Koontz; and children David (Linda), Winona Lake, Doug, Warsaw, and Steve (Christine), Winona Lake. Also surviving are his grandchildren, Ashley (John) Miller and Beth, Kate, Scott and Michael Koontz; and two great-granddaughters.
He was preceded in death by his parents; and brother Kenneth D. Koontz.
